/Painting3dModel

Painterly Rendering 3d Model based on PatchMatch algorithm

Primary LanguageMATLAB

Painterly Rendering 3D Models via PatchMatch Algorithm

Developed by Jiayi Chen.

This repository contains a MATLAB implementation of StyLit by Jakub Fišer,et al.

Requirements

Matlab 2017b +

Getting Started

main_LPE.m
  • input folder: /images (see here for the data)
  • output folder: /results

Result example

image

References

  1. Connelly Barnes, Eli Shechtman, Adam Finkelstein, and Dan B Goldman. PatchMatch: A Randomized Correspondence Algorithm for Structural Image Editing. ACM Transactions on Graphics (Proc. SIGGRAPH) 28(3), August 2009. PatchMatch
  2. Fišer, Jakub, et al. StyLit: illumination-guided example-based stylization of 3D renderings." ACM Transactions on Graphics (TOG) 35.4 (2016): 92. StyLit